Output 31531481be7f8bf9a33a1a1e960b832804d74ef1faf74e05a486cfd386478920:5

value
129140163
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 510d56e70a3aca24699669a9a6275209d9e209a658f1906df831bbdf7174fcf2
address
bc1p2yx4dec28t9zg6vkdx56vf6jp8v7yzdxtrceqm0cxxaa7ut5lneqwd94hg
transaction
31531481be7f8bf9a33a1a1e960b832804d74ef1faf74e05a486cfd386478920
spent
true